~ B.C.G.S. Library Resources~    

 1) Berrien Springs Community Library
Address: 215 W. Union Street, Berrien Springs, MI  49103 
Phone: (269) 471-7074  www.bsclibrary.org
Hours:
  Monday-Thursday 10-8; Friday 10-6; Saturday 10-4

The Berrien Springs Community Library has provided a room for the Berrien County Genealogical Society holdings.  You can ask for the key at the front desk of the library.  Please be courteous and place your research materials back in the location where you found them.  None of the materials in the BCGS room can be checked out, all research must be done at the library. 2) LDS Family History Center (FHC) New Location:
    Address:   3711 Niles Rd
                       
ST JOSEPH , MI 49085

    Phone:     (269) 408-0068
    Hours:
     Wednesdays 6:30 p.m.- 8:30 p.m.
                      (Family History Center is closed on holidays and days of inclement weather)

Workshops held the 2nd Tuesday of each month at 7:00 at the LDS Family History Center.

 

 

The Family History Center in St. Joseph is a branch library of the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ints that is open to the public. The Family History Center is a great resource for ordering films from the Salt Lake library on either a short-term rental or extended loan.

The Berrien County Genealogical Society has ordered in all of the vital records that have been microfilmed for Berrien County on extended loan and you are welcome to come in and view them. The FHC has two microfilm readers and two microfiche readers for your convenience. There is a staff that will be happy to help you get started on your research (free of charge).
